This is also how Machiavelli uses the certainty of fortune to condone the importance of free will in the lives of these men he coaches. Machiavelli also seems to understand that there is a contradiction between free will and fortune as well, that if some part of life is mere luck, then the idea of changing your future cannot be obtained. He seems to limit the power of free will with this contradiction, saying that only half of life can be controlled by free will and the other half of life is controlled by fortune alone.
